The Project
The project involves the cut & carve refurbishment and conversion of an existing building into a high-quality hospitality venue. Works include structural alterations, internal reconfiguration, MEP coordination, and high-specification fit out.
The scheme presents logistical and technical challenges typical of City of London projects, providing excellent experience for a commercially ambitious Assistant QS.
The Role
Reporting to a Senior Quantity Surveyor, you will support the commercial management of the project from procurement through to final account.
Your responsibilities will include:
Assisting with procurement of subcontract packages
Supporting subcontractor management and administration
Preparing and assisting with interim valuations and cost reports
Managing and tracking variations and change control
Assisting with subcontractor payments and final accounts
Monitoring project costs and maintaining accurate commercial records
Attending site and commercial meetings as required
Supporting the commercial team to ensure financial targets are achievedYou will gain full exposure to the commercial lifecycle of a complex refurbishment project.
